The ELF shell library is the binary manipulation library of the ELF shell. It contains primitives for static on-disk modifications and consultation of binary programs linked within the Executable & Linking Format (ELF) 32bits or 64bits.
The main features of the ELF shell library are :
* Full API for all ELF structures. * ET_REL injection into ET_EXEC/ET_DYN ELF files. * ALTGOT redirection technique, for external functions redirections on RISC architectures. * ALTPLT redirection technique, for external functions redirections. * CFLOW redirection technique, for internal functions redirections. * EXTPLT partial relinking technique, for adding unknown extern symbols to the program. * EXTSTATIC static file relinking technique. * Partial SHT reconstruction technique. * PaX protection attributes access in RW mode. * Core files manipulation.
|
|
|
| Architecture | Package Size | Installed Size | Files |
|---|---|---|---|
| amd64 | 445.1 kB | 1073 kB | [list of files] |
| hppa | 422.5 kB | 1304 kB | [list of files] |
| i386 | 373.6 kB | 1076 kB | [list of files] |
| ia64 | 498.3 kB | 2196 kB | [list of files] |
| mips | 307.7 kB | 1416 kB | [list of files] |
| mipsel | 307.5 kB | 1416 kB | [list of files] |
| powerpc | 403.9 kB | 1220 kB | [list of files] |
| s390 | 375.5 kB | 1252 kB | [list of files] |
| sparc | 384.6 kB | 1280 kB | [list of files] |